Does anyone know a good mp3 editing program that can be used to edit mp3 files so they can be used as backing tracks? Especially the capability to suppress lead or rythm guitar parts and re-record to the SD card for play along. I am using Sonar Home Studio for MIDI files and it works great, but I haven't found a decent program for mp3.

Fender has provided a few mp3's with the original artist's vocals and the guitar parts have been suppressed. They're great but there's not enough of the Golden Oldies available.

Any suggestions will be appreciated. Thanks

Try this...In Fuse go to the dropdown list in the backing track dialogue box and where you can choose mono or stereo you can pick cancel center and it takes out most of the vocals and if it is an instrumental, it takes out the lead guitar. Do the preview to listen to it before you commit.
